Turkey's daily power consumption down 0.88% on April 2

- Turkey's electricity exports amount to 7,074 megawatt-hours, while imports total 2,860 megawatt-hours on Thursday

Turkey's daily electricity consumption decreased by 0.88% to 708,371 megawatt-hours on Thursday, according to official figures of Turkish Electricity Transmission Corporation (TEIAS) on Friday.

Hourly power consumption peaked at 20.00 local time with 33,679 megawatt-hours, data from TEIAS showed. The country's electricity usage dropped to its lowest level of 24,590 megawatt-hours at 07.00 local time.

Total electricity production reached 712,585 megawatt-hours on Thursday with a 0.22% decrease compared to the previous day.

The majority of the output came from hydroelectricity plants at 232,524 megawatt-hours. Run-of-river hydroelectricity and import coal plants followed with 109,490 megawatt-hours and 104,940 megawatt-hours, respectively.

On Thursday, Turkey's electricity exports amounted to 7,074 megawatt-hours, while imports totaled 2,860 megawatt-hours.
